Partizan President: Dubai Game to Be Postponed as EuroLeague Faces UAE Travel Shutdown
He warns the competition’s schedule is in doubt due to player safety concerns.
Overview
- Ostoja Mijailovic says Partizan’s Round 30 matchup in Dubai will be suspended following airport closures in Dubai and Abu Dhabi.
- He confirms Partizan players Dylan Osetkowski, Duane Washington Jr., and Shake Milton are stuck in the United Arab Emirates after a short trip.
- Mijailovic adds that 14 EuroLeague players and Fenerbahce coach Sarunas Jasikevicius are also stranded in Dubai.
- Partizan reports its players are in constant contact with the club and have been permitted to train locally in Dubai.
- The president says the integrity of the 2025–26 season is at risk and that the club is awaiting direction from EuroLeague leadership.
